Tax Evasion: PRA freezes account of National Manpower Bureau

LAHORE: The Punjab Revenue Authority (PRA) has frozen the bank account of National Manpower Bureau and recovered Rs 12.4 from its account.

Sources told Customs Today that PRA issued a number of notices to the company but it ignored the notices. After its non-compliance to PRA notices, the PRA authorities decided to freeze its bank account.

The recovery operation of Rs 12.4 million was conducted under the supervision of DSP Punjab Police Mian Ijaz.
